如何使用Redgate,Toad比较两个Oracle模式(DEV vs Pre-prod)并创建定义文件(.def / .onp)?
答案 0 :(得分:1)
RedGate有" Schema Compare for Oracle"工具。看看短视频 - 你会得到一个想法。
作为源和目标,您可以使用与#34; Source Control forr Oracle"生成的脚本的数据库,快照或目录的实时连接。 (这也非常有用)。 如果您没有直接连接到Prod数据库,快照非常方便,例如:你可以让Prod团队生成快照,然后用它来与非Prod数据库进行比较。 作为比较的结果,您将获得不同对象的列表,您可以按类型过滤它们,然后为目标数据库生成部署脚本(右侧)。然后您可以保存或立即执行。 我使用命令行工具来自动执行此操作。 因此,只需花一些时间在评估期间使用这些工具。 您可能会看到一些不受支持的对象要比较等,但这个世界并不理想; - )
我不能评论TOAD - 不要使用它。
答案 1 :(得分:0)
Toad菜单数据库 数据库 - >比较 - >模式
您必须连接到两个实例。